Induced mutant for male-sterility of lentil

Full text: Lentil has very small flowers which pose problems in emasculation for cross-breeding. To induce mutations, seeds of variety LL-78 were irradiated with gamma rays 5 to 20 krad. In M2 some male-sterile plants were observed. Male-sterile plants could easily be identified at the start of maturity. They remain green and continue flowering when other plants mature. Due to natural outcrossing a few seeds formed on these male-sterile plants. These were grown in M2 for progeny testing. Some M3 lines were having both normal seed set and male-sterile plants in the ratio of 3 normal : 1 male-sterile, whereas in other lines all the plants were male-sterile. The former are assumed to be genic male-sterile and the latter cytoplasmic male-sterile. When the putative cytoplasmic male-sterile plants were selfed, there was no seed setting. Cytoplasmic male-sterility has not yet been reported in lentil. its use could make cross-breeding easier. (author)
